Installation of steering rack and pinion assembly on vehicle: 1. Fit rubber seal on steering rack assembly in proper alignment. NOTE: Please ensure the correct fitment of rubber seal on steering rack assembly 2. Insert steering rack and pinion tie rod ends through either side of steering knuckle. 3. Tighten both tie rod ball joint nyloc nut to specified torque. Tightening torque as per specified. 4. Tighten upper universal joint bolt to specified torque. Tightening torque as per specified. 5. Tighten lower universal joint bolt to specified torque. (Thus securing steering column with rack). Tightening torque as per specified. 6. Check for toe settings and do wheel alignment if required. Refer wheel alignment procedure). 7. Refit both front wheels. NOTE:  After replacement of Column / ECU / Wheel alignment is necessary after installation (Refer wheel alignment procedure).  After replacement of Column / ECU / Intermediate / Rack & pinion: Read DTC using diagnostic tool.  If warning lamp is OFF and no heavy steering is observed, then ignore this DTC U1609-81.  If warning lamp is OFF and heavy steering is observed, then check for other DTCs logged along with this DTC U1609-81. (Refer diagnostic tool user manual for trouble shooting).
